Criteria
In selecting entries for the exhibition, the jury will give prime consideration to the architectural solution of the stated educational program requirements. The design solution should be uniquely adapted to the educational program and should clearly reflect the challenge presented and how the architect met this challenge in the response to function and aesthetics. Specifically, the jury will give consideration to the following:
- response to educational program
- organization of instructional areas
- flexibility
- technology systems
- community use
- site development
- overall presentation
